Understanding the Function of Fork Oil
The function of fork oil is a sophisticated dance of physics happening in real-time. When a motorcycle encounters a bump, the fork tube slides down the inner stanchion, compressing the spring. This action requires the oil to be forced through precisely calibrated valving orifices. The resistance created by this fluid flow is what absorbs the energy of the impact, preventing the wheel from simply transmitting the shock directly to the frame. Conversely, as the suspension returns to its neutral position, the oil flows back, providing the damping force that prevents the bike from bouncing uncontrollably. The viscosity, or weight, of the oil is the primary variable in tuning this process for a specific rider and bike.

Signs Your Fork Oil Needs Attention
Even with a regular maintenance schedule, certain symptoms indicate that your fork oil is overdue for a change or that there is a more serious issue developing. A noticeable change in ride quality is the most common indicator. If the front end feels harsh, dives excessively, or bounces more than usual, the damping characteristics of the oil have likely broken down. Oil leaks around the fork tubes or visible contamination, such as metal shavings suspended in the fluid, are serious warning signs that point to internal seal or component failure. Addressing these symptoms promptly can prevent a minor issue from escalating into a major and expensive repair.
